JOB PURPOSE

We are looking for a Digital Product Designer to create unparalleled customer and brand experiences on our luxury fashion e-commerce site.

Working with a talented team of Designers across multi-disciplined functions, in making our products useful, usable and delightful for the Burberry customer, across our Web and Mobile platforms.

You must have a user centred approach to your work and have experience designing beautiful and intuitive experiences that you have crafted with input from real user insight, analytics, brand and validated through testing.

You have a passion for emerging technologies and pride yourself on being up to date with the latest digital product design trends and practices.

As a key member of the Digital team, you will be using your talents in a collaborative and agile environment where you are empowered to challenge and progress our thinking and working methods.

You will be collaborating with our developers and delivery partners to ensure we maintain the good working practices and exploit the best and latest technology.

You'll have a broad skill set and being conformable with customer journey mapping, user research/testing, workshopping, creating product wireframes, interactive prototypes, UI design, applied UX techniques & Interaction design.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Taking designs from sketching and prototyping through to implementation, solving both macro and micro problems.
  • Partnering and working closely with UX Research, Product Managers, Engineering and Business Analysts to solve complex business problems which results in delightful customer experiences.
  • Leading on projects and apply initiative in a fast paced environment.


PERSONAL PROFILE

  • Extensive experience in a UX/UI or Product design type role. A portfolio featuring examples of end-to-end design solutions would be desirable.
  • Ideally experience working in an Agile process.
  • Understanding of best practice User Experience approaches and how to apply them.
  • Experience of working with cross-functional teams across multiple time zones effectively.
  • Experience working with Proto.io, Principle, Sketch and Adobe suite.
  • Knowledge of testing tools and methods such as AB/MVT, Guerrilla or Remote.
  • Experience of developing eCommerce experiences across different connected devices.
  • A solid understanding and passion for detailed interaction and information design.
  • Being structured in approach to understanding users, and frame design decisions around your findings.
  • Working with brand and style guidelines to design and prototype to a high resolution that go beyond wireframes is essential.
  • A point of view and strong sensibility for fashion aesthetics.
  • Ability to support your ideas with real customer insight, working closely with the insights teams.
